Commit 388804bf by txy

'调整获取域名'

parent 4b20a79d
...@@ -35,13 +35,11 @@ function getToken() { ...@@ -35,13 +35,11 @@ function getToken() {
return t return t
} }
// 页面跳转 // 获取域名及二级目录
function transPage(_pageNumber, _activityCode, _token, _addParam) { function getBaseOrigin(){
var url = '';
var _base = ''; var _base = '';
var _origin = window.location.origin; var _origin = window.location.origin;
var _pathname = window.location.pathname; var _pathname = window.location.pathname;
var _urlParam = window.location.search;
var index = _pathname.indexOf('/ACTIVITY'); var index = _pathname.indexOf('/ACTIVITY');
var _secondFolder = ''; var _secondFolder = '';
...@@ -50,6 +48,16 @@ function transPage(_pageNumber, _activityCode, _token, _addParam) { ...@@ -50,6 +48,16 @@ function transPage(_pageNumber, _activityCode, _token, _addParam) {
} }
_base = _origin + _secondFolder; _base = _origin + _secondFolder;
return _base;
}
// 页面跳转
function transPage(_pageNumber, _activityCode, _token, _addParam) {
var url = '';
var _base = '';
var _urlParam = window.location.search;
_base = getBaseOrigin();
if (typeof _urlParam !== 'undefined' && _urlParam !== '') { if (typeof _urlParam !== 'undefined' && _urlParam !== '') {
url = _base + "/ACTIVITY/view/" + _activityCode + "/" + _pageNumber + _urlParam + (_addParam !== undefined ? ('&' + _addParam) : ''); url = _base + "/ACTIVITY/view/" + _activityCode + "/" + _pageNumber + _urlParam + (_addParam !== undefined ? ('&' + _addParam) : '');
} else { } else {
......
...@@ -14,6 +14,9 @@ wx.config({ ...@@ -14,6 +14,9 @@ wx.config({
}); });
wx.ready(function(){ wx.ready(function(){
// 获取域名
var _base = getBaseOrigin();
var shareData = { var shareData = {
title: _settings.szText.shareTitile, title: _settings.szText.shareTitile,
imgUrl: _settings.szText.shareIcon, imgUrl: _settings.szText.shareIcon,
...@@ -21,17 +24,19 @@ wx.ready(function(){ ...@@ -21,17 +24,19 @@ wx.ready(function(){
link: "" link: ""
} }
var auth_id = getQueryString('auth_id');
auth_id = auth_id !== null ? '&auth_id='+auth_id : '';
// 已报名 // 已报名
if (user.status) { if (user.status) {
shareData.title = _settings.szText.pullTitile; shareData.title = _settings.szText.pullTitile;
shareData.desc = _settings.szText.pullSubtitle.replace("{{姓名}}", user.name); shareData.desc = _settings.szText.pullSubtitle.replace("{{姓名}}", user.name);
shareData.link = "/ACTIVITY/view/" + activityCode + "/3?userId="+user.id; shareData.link = _base + "/ACTIVITY/view/" + activityCode + "/3?activityCode="+activityCode+'&bindId='+getQueryString("bindId") + "&userId="+ user.id + auth_id;
}else { }else {
// 分享首页 // 分享首页
shareData.title = _settings.szText.shareTitile; shareData.title = _settings.szText.shareTitile;
shareData.desc = _settings.szText.shareSubtitle; shareData.desc = _settings.szText.shareSubtitle;
shareData.link = "/ACTIVITY/view/" + activityCode + "/1"; shareData.link = _base + "/ACTIVITY/view/" + activityCode + "/1?activityCode="+activityCode+'&bindId='+getQueryString("bindId") + auth_id;
} }
/** /**
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ment